ETHYL CORPORATION v. BORDEN, INC.

Civ. A. No. 3517.

300 F.Supp. 1325 (1969)

ETHYL CORPORATION, Plaintiff, v. BORDEN, INC., Defendant.

United States District Court D. Delaware.

June 26, 1969.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Nathan Bakalar and James M. Mulligan, Jr., Connolly, Bove & Lodge, Wilmington, Del., Donald L. Johnson, John F. Sieberth, and E. Donald Mays, Baton Rouge, La., of counsel, for plaintiff.

Murray M. Schwartz, Longobardi & Schwartz, Wilmington, Del., Ellsworth H. Mosher and Farrell Roy Werbow, Stevens, Davis, Miller & Mosher, Washington, D. C., George P. Maskas, New York City, of counsel, for defendant.


OPINION

CALEB M. WRIGHT, Chief Judge.

This is an action by plaintiff, Ethyl Corporation, against defendant, Borden, Inc., for a declaratory judgment that defendant's United States Patent 3,297,155 is invalid, unenforceable, and not infringed. Defendant denies the essential allegations of plaintiff's complaint and counterclaims charging that two of plaintiff's products infringe the patent. Jurisdiction and venue are based on 28 U.S.C. §§ 1338, 1391...
